new york - The man who wrote a hateful mourning ad about his mother and who saw it going viral, speaks of the neglect that he and his sister, according to his own words, has fallen.

'We wanted to have the last word', says Jay Dehmalo (58) against the Daily Mail. He wrote about his mother that she 'will not be missed' and that the world 'now has become a better place'. Painful, but not unjustified, says Dehmalo himself. 'You can not think of what we went through. '

Dehmalo wrote the funeral ad with sister Gina (60). Both have not had contact with their mother Kathleen Dehmlow for years, have changed their name slightly to erase the past, and were told by a nephew that their mother was lying on the deathbed.
